How old should a child be when they sit in the passenger seat of a car with an airbag?

13 years old. Kids 12 and under are MUCH safer riding in the back seat.


What age do you need to sit in the passenger seat in Utah?

In Utah, children are required to be at least 8 years old to sit in the front passenger seat of a vehicle. However, it is recommended that children under 13 years old remain in the back seat for safety reasons. Additionally, all passengers must wear seat belts, regardless of their seating position.
